前言
随着前端技术的飞速发展,大家对于如何提高开发效率和代码质量越发关注。npm 作为包管理工具,为我们提供了众多高质量的第三方库,帮助我们更快速、更优雅地完成开发任务。其中,x10cv 就是一个很好的 npm 包,本文将介绍其使用教程。
什么是 x10cv?
x10cv 是一款开源的、轻量级的前端框架,它基于 Vue.js 和 Tailwind CSS,提供丰富的应用组件和 UI 组件,可以极大程度地提高开发效率和代码质量。
如何安装 x10cv?
使用 x10cv 很简单,只需要在终端中输入以下命令:
npm install x10cv
x10cv 的使用
引入 x10cv
在 Vue 项目中使用 x10cv,我们需要先引入该组件库。在 Vue 文件中,我们可以这样写:
-- -------------------- ---- ------- ------ ----- ---- ------- ------ ---------------------- ------ ------- - ----------- - ------ -- -- --- -
使用 x10cv 组件
在 Vue 文件中我们可以直接使用 x10cv 提供的组件,如下:
<x10cv-button>Click me</x10cv-button>
其中,<x10cv-button>
是 x10cv 提供的一个组件,表示一个按钮,我们在标签中输入 Display 字符串,就可以在页面上生成一个带有 Click me 字符串的按钮。
x10cv 提供的组件非常多,比如表单、布局、图标等等,具体可以参考官方文档:https://x10cv.com/components。
自定义主题
在项目中,我们可能需要根据自己的品牌色或项目需求来自定义组件主题。x10cv 在此方面也提供了很好的支持。
在项目的入口文件中,我们可以使用 Vue.use() 函数安装 x10cv 插件,并传入一个配置对象。其中,配置中的 theme 配置项就可以用来自定义主题。
-- -------------------- ---- ------- ------ --- ---- ----- ------ ----- ---- ------- ------ ---------------------- -------------- - ------ - ------- - -------- ---------- -------- ---------- -------- ---------- ------- ---------- ----- ---------- -- -- --
上面的代码中,我们使用了 Vue.use() 函数来安装 x10cv 插件,并传入一个配置对象。其中,colors 属性用来指定组件的颜色主题,可以根据自己的需求进行配置。
编写示例代码
下面我们编写一个示例代码,让大家更好地了解 x10cv 的使用方法:
-- -------------------- ---- ------- ---------- ----- ---------- ----------- ------------- -------------------------- ----------------- ----------- -- ----------- ----------- -- ------ ----------- -------- ------ ----- ---- ------- ------ ---------------------- ------ ------- - ----- ------ ----------- - ------ -- -------- - ------------- - ------------------- -------- -- -- - --------- ------- -- - ------ ----- - --------
上面的代码中,我们使用了 x10cv 提供的 x10cv-button
、x10cv-logo
、x10cv-icon
组件,并在其中加入了一些 JavaScript 和 CSS 代码,让页面更加丰富、美观。
总结
x10cv 是一款很好用的前端框架,它有着完善的组件库和主题定制功能,可以满足各种项目需求。希望本教程对大家有所帮助,如果有疑问,欢迎在评论区留言。
来源:JavaScript中文网 ,转载请注明来源 https://www.javascriptcn.com/post/60055fbf81e8991b448dd09f